Here is an example that demonstrates how to convert PDF to PPTX in CLI. You can follow these easy steps to convert your PDF file to PPTX format. First, upload your PDF file and then simply save it as a PPTX file. You can use fully qualified filenames for both PDF reading and PPTX writing. The output PPTX content and formatting will be identical to the original PDF document.

Convert PDF to PPTX using Aspose.PDF for Aspose.PDF CLI
Aspose.PDF CLI is a PDF processing App that allows reading, writing, manipulating, and rendering PDF documents. It has a simple and easy-to-use API for developers. With Aspose.PDF CLI, you can easily convert text and images, and convert PDF to various document formats with high performance and quality.
